Transaction 50ea2489c4c76d702968e3209646a144780a80ba8122fdf745642e542c63471a

4 Input
2 Outputs
  • 50ea2489c4c76d702968e3209646a144780a80ba8122fdf745642e542c63471a:0
  • value  1029397
    address  2MxAozUoWGXVzfrrkwYYruDHRk8oDcK2wmK
  • 50ea2489c4c76d702968e3209646a144780a80ba8122fdf745642e542c63471a:1
  • value  1000000
    address  2MwLGQ4Rqg95AxA2W7iivRq6gYp6y3i1DKZ